Posted by: daveyboybadion Apr 7 2007, 04:58 PM

WTF.gif I am in the process of gathering core parts for a 2060 build up of my 1.8 engine. I have sourced 2.0 lt rods and a crank but they are out of the block already. How do I determine if I am buying the actual rods and crank that I need? I'm quessing the rod should measure 71 mm from the big end center to the little end center, but what about the crank? Any casting marks or measurements to indicate the differences between a 1.8 and a 2.0? Thanks for the help...daveyboy

Posted by: davep Apr 7 2007, 05:11 PM

No, the rods are NOT 71mm long.
Measure the center of one rod journal to the center of the rod journal on the other side of the crank instead.

Posted by: daveyboybadion Apr 7 2007, 05:50 PM

Ok that makes sense, what about identifying the rods?...daveyboy

Posted by: Bleyseng Apr 7 2007, 06:09 PM

Easy, 66 mm rods have a huge block of steel on the smallend of the rod, 71mm rods don't.
